ECP also … WebThis is where Emission Factors come into play. An Emission Factor (EF) is a representative value that attempts to relate the quantity of a pollutant released to the atmosphere with an activity associated with the release of that pollutant. In other words, it is an average rate that converts activity data into GHG emissions, usually given in the ...
